NHTSA Campaign Id 99V215000; Date: Aug. 9, 1999
If this occurs, the transmission half-shaft could pull out of the transaxle and result in loss of power.
1993 Chrysler Concorde; 1994 Chrysler Concorde; 1995 Chrysler Concorde; 1993 Chrysler LHS; 1994 Chrysler LHS; 1995 Chrysler LHS; 1993 Chrysler New Yorker; 1994 Chrysler New Yorker; 1995 Chrysler New Yorker; 1993 Dodge Intrepid; 1994 Dodge Intrepid; 1995 Dodge Intrepid; 1993 Eagle Vision; 1994 Eagle Vision; 1995 Eagle Vision
Component: Suspension:front:control Arm:lower Arm
Manufactured by: Daimlerchrysler Corporation
Affected Units:: 402,830
Vehicle description: passenger vehicles. The lower control arm attaching brackets can crack due to fatigue and separate from the engine cradle.
Dealers will reinforce the engine cradle at the point where the lower control arm attaches to it.
Owner notification began February 7, 2000.
